Keybank National Association OH Sells 4,271 Shares of NetApp, Inc. (NASDAQ:NTAP)

Keybank National Association OH trimmed its stake in shares of NetApp, Inc. (NASDAQ:NTAPFree Report) by 15.4%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 23,418 shares of the data storage provider’s stock after selling 4,271 shares during the quarter. Keybank National Association OH’s holdings in NetApp were worth $2,718,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

About NetApp

(Free Report)

NetApp, Inc provides cloud-led and data-centric services to manage and share data on-premises, and private and public clouds worldwide. It operates in two segments, Hybrid Cloud and Public Could. The company offers intelligent data management software, such as NetApp ONTAP, NetApp Snapshot, NetApp SnapCenter Backup Management, NetApp SnapMirror Data Replication, NetApp SnapLock Data Compliance, and storage infrastructure solutions, including NetApp All-Flash FAS series, NetApp Fabric Attached Storage, NetApp E/EF series, and NetApp StorageGRID.
